Dascha Polanco Assault Charges To Be Dismissed
Charges against Dascha Polanco for assaulting a teen last summer will be dismissed if the actress stays on the straight and narrow for six months.
The “Orange is the New Black” star was arrested on July 29 for allegedly punching, scratching, and pulling the hair of 17-year-old Michelle Cardona in front of her Washington Heights home.
Here’s the scoop via Page Six:
Assistant District Attorney Christopher Dey said the decision to offer what is known in legal parlance as an adjournment in contemplation of dismissal was based on a thorough investigation, including interviews with the alleged victim.
“She suffered only superficial abrasions and bruising,” the prosecutor said of the teen girl’s injuries.
Dey also said that it was an appropriate disposition given that Polanco had no criminal record prior to the incident.
A glamorous-looking Polanco declined to comment as she left Manhattan Criminal Court wearing her hair in loose ringlets and sporting gold-rimmed sunglasses.
The Brooklyn-bred actress was originally booked on assault, attempted assault and harassment raps for the July 29 melee in her Washington Heights pad on W. 190th St.
It was unclear what led to the alleged beatdown but Polanco had invited Cardona to her apartment, cops said.
“Ms. Cardona observed the defendant strike Ms. Cardona about the face and head with a closed fist at least three times, pull Ms. Cardona’s hair, and strike Ms. Cardona’s arms with the defendant’s hands and nails,” the criminal complaint alleges.
Defense lawyers for the curvy, Dominican-born beauty have insisted from the start that Cardona was “motivated by the prospects of a payday.”
“She (Cardona) devised a plan to have Ms. Polanco pay her to withdraw the charges, which was furthered by a campaign of harassment directed at Ms. Polanco and her family and jeopardized their safety,” attorney Gerald Lefcourt said in a statement.
“Fortunately, we had irrefutable evidence of the complainant’s misdeeds on tape, including her extortions attempts.”
